Output 274060de812357a3b640ab039de1f4d88455ed3ec16dceb86fdca0ee7d31b55c:25

value
105737001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8fc168a07ad6362a4c46a84d7e2f46a155b3d7 OP_EQUAL
address
3MtXUFCqD3nBmkcC44P6FqYHJSCDj68oms
transaction
274060de812357a3b640ab039de1f4d88455ed3ec16dceb86fdca0ee7d31b55c
spent
true